Press Release: "Visit of the Department of Economics, Universitas Brawijaya to FEB UPN 'Veteran' Yogyakarta"

The Department of Economics, Faculty of Economics and Business, Universitas Brawijaya (FEB UB) conducted a visit to the Faculty of Economics and Business, UPN "Veteran" Yogyakarta as part of the initiation for implementing a collaboration in the Tri Dharma of Higher Education. The meeting was also attended by the leadership of FEB UPN "Veteran" Yogyakarta and the management of the Department of Economics. This activity is part of the follow-up to the collaboration that has been established between FEB UPN "Veteran" Yogyakarta and FEB Universitas Brawijaya since 2024, aimed at supporting the implementation of the Tri Dharma of Higher Education.

The meeting discussed various opportunities for collaboration through the presentation of the Collaboration Areas, which include three main fields:

  1. Academics: covering Student Exchange programs, Staff Mobility, Sabbatical Leave, Joint Curriculum, Summer School, Joint Conferences, Visiting Professors, the 3in1 Program, IISMA, International Book Chapters, Joint Supervision & Examination, and International Colloquiums.

  2. Research: including Research Fellowships, Joint Publications, Joint Research, roles as Journal Editors and Reviewers, and Adjunct Professorships.

  3. Community Services: including International Community Service programs, Joint Publications in Community Service, and the development of Village Laboratories.
